Book excerpt: This dissertation analyzes whether or not the principle of systemic integration - as expounded in Article 31(3)(c) of the Vienna Convention on the Law of Treaties - contributes to attainment of a coherent international legal system. For this purpose, the book considers three general ideas: the "unity" of the international legal system and fragmentation; the general rule on treaty interpretation and the principle of systemic integration; and the role of systemic integration in the achievement of coherence. Each one involves specific issues and considerations which ultimately assist in addressing the main question as to the usefulness of the principle in the curtailment of fragmentation in the international legal system. Book excerpt: In Article 31(3)(c) VCLT and the Principle of Systemic Integration: Normative Shadows in Plato’s Cave the author tackles a provision on treaty interpretation that has risen in prominence, Article 31(3)(c) VCLT. This article, which enshrines the principle of systemic integration, and its exact scope has become and continues to be a hotly debated subject in academic and judicial circles. Through an examination of both its written and unwritten elements, the author argues that the ‘proximity criterion’ is the optimal way of understanding and utilizing this provision, that conflict resolution principles may be of use within Article 31(3)(c) and finally, that the principle of systemic integration is indispensable not only for interpreting treaty provisions but customary international law as well.

Book excerpt: International law has greatly expanded in reach and density over the past few decades and its fragmented and decentralized nature is causing anxiety among those who need to resolve legal dilemmas in a system that lacks vertical hierarchy. Although the principle of systemic integration is embodied in Article 31(3)(c) of the Vienna Convention 1969, its operation and significance has not been fully assessed. The Principle of Systemic Integration in International Law fills this research gap by analysing the manner in which the principle has been applied in the judicial decisions of international courts and tribunals, together with the practice of states and international organizations in the framing of international instruments and their application. Building upon the framework he first pioneered in 2005 and the culmination of two decades of academic research and practical experience in international law, the author Campbell McLachlan KC closely examines legislative texts and cases to reflect on the principle's theoretical foundations and actual application in practice. The book argues that the principle of systemic integration contributes to an orderly framework within which conflicts between institutions and between legal norms may be addressed. It explores how disparate parts of international law are integrated in the development of bilateral and multilateral treaties and, finally, analyses the operation of the principle in international courts and tribunals.
